Controversial Member of Parliament Mervyn Silva who was well know for his anti media stunts including the forceful entry into the state owned Rupavahini was sworn in today as the Deputy Media Minister before President Mahinda Rajapakse.

While taking oaths, the Deputy Minister was seen showing his arm to the President and explaining something which had happened to him and when he was about to sign his official document, the pen on the table failed to write and he had to use his own pen.

Mervyn Silva has been well known for his many attacks against organizations such as Sirasa and the Sri Lanka Rupavahini Corporation where he was taken hostage by the employees when he tried to assault senior staff members.

Some of those who had condemned Mervyn Silva for this attack were then Minister of Media Anura Priyadarshana Yapa and SLFP General Secretary Maithripala Sirisena. (Daily Mirror online)
